Third grade concluded their writing unit with a special presentation about service dogs. Laura Theurer and her seeing eye dog in training, Gino, were able to visit with all third graders. The guest speaker, who is a volunteer from the Dauphin County 4 –H Seeing Eye Program, was able to explain the jobs and responsibilities of the service animal along with the roles of a trainer.
